In reply to:
Is there still a problem with Outlook Express following the google migration? My folks still can't get theirs to work
Are you sure that it has been set up correctly?
The change of ports, the SSL being ticked, and having to use the full mail address rather that just the username are a few things that have to be changed as well as the word "tools" being inserted for the server address.
